> I use the MSXML processor XSLt, and my applications have
> occupy many time to
> transform.
> Someone know a processor XSLt most fast to run in local
> Windows platform (not Web)?
>

I suggest you look at your stylesheets to work out why they are slow. It's
very unlikely you will solve your performance problems by switching to a
different processor. It's much more likely that you can solve the problems
by changing your code.
